Overview

Bifidobacterium breve SHMB 8001 is a novel probiotic strain isolated from human milk, currently being investigated as a live biotherapeutic for the treatment of inflammatory bowel disease (IBD). In preclinical studies using DSS-induced colitis mouse models, the strain demonstrated significant anti-inflammatory properties. Its mechanism of action involves the restoration of intestinal barrier integrity by upregulating tight junction proteins, specifically occludin and claudin-1, and the modulation of the gut microbiota community. Furthermore, SHMB 8001 administration leads to a reduction in the levels of key proinflammatory cytokines, including TNF-α, IL-1β, and IL-6. The development is being led by researchers at Shanghai Children’s Hospital and Shanghai Jiao Tong University.
